On the startup menu, choose "BIOS setup," or "BIOS settings," or something similar. Procedures vary depending on the BIOS manufacturer. Usually, you must press a key (such as F2, F12, Delete, Esc) or a key combination immediately after you turn on your computer but before Windows starts.
